Smart Grids for Renewable Energy and Energy Efficiency (SGREEE) (Finished)




Period
07/2017 - 06/2022
Funding Agencies
Federal Ministry of Economic Cooperation and Development (BMZ)
German Climate Technology Initiative (DKTI)
Partners
Political Partner: Viet Nam’s Ministry of Industry and Trade
Implementing Agency: Electricity Regulatory Authority of Vietnam (ERAV)
Activities
The ‘Smart Grids for Renewable Energy and Energy Efficiency (SGREEE)’ project is supporting the Government of Viet Nam in the implementation of its Smart Grid Roadmap, which aims to promote the modernization and automation of the national power transmission and distribution system. Funded by BMZ, the project is working closely with ERAV to support experts of the Vietnamese power sector in developing a “Smart Grid”, i.e. the digitalization and flexibilization of the power supply system, which allows integration of an increasing share of renewable energies and supports greater energy efficiency.
Exemplary activities in the project’s three action areas include:
Legal and Regulatory Framework
● Strategic advice on future power system development and establishment of a sector-wide stakeholder dialogue
● Supporting the development of regulations with the emphasis on the grid integration of renewable energies as well as the flexibilization and digitalization of the power system with smart technologies
Capacity Development
● Establishing a Knowledge Network on smart grid technologies for Vietnamese power system experts
● Trainings on Smart Grid technologies, innovative power system operation and planning with high shares of renewable energies
Technology Cooperation
● Promoting the application of state-of-the-art Smart Grid technologies
● Intensifying applied research and development, e.g. feasibility tests for smart technology system configurations in laboratories
